BIG M presents: THE BREAKBEAT JUNKIE vs. DJP (2012)

BIG M presents: THE BREAKBEAT JUNKIE vs. DJP (2012)
Funky breaks dream team The Breakbeat Junkie and DJP hook-up again and cook up some new heat for the Big M label – three joint efforts and DJP’s solo banger Say Word. I’m always a sucker for party hip-hop so it’s the latter that takes my fancy the most with its inspired employment of Treacherous Three and solo Spoonie G vocals. You can’t get much more old school than that and the results sound like the kind of hook-laden feel-good track that seems perpetually just beyond People Under The Stairs grasp. Nice one DJP. THE BREAKBEAT JUNKIE & DJP: Goodgroove Artist Series no. 10

THE BREAKBEAT JUNKIE & DJP: Goodgroove Artist Series no. 10
Bath’s Goodgroove label lives up to it’s name once more and shows hip-hop producers the way back to the dancefloor. The recipe is simple, take one old school hip-hop acapella circa 1985, take one old funk loop circa 1967-1975, forgo the tired ‘dusty breaks’-re-creation-of-1992-approach and instead apply muscular 21st century club vibe instead.
